推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
ZFS是Linux操作系统中一种先进的文件系统,具有多重特性。它支持数据校验、快照、克隆和池化管理,确保数据安全和高效存储。ZFS还具备动态条带化、自动重平衡和压缩功能,优化性能和空间利用率。其Windows移植版同样继承了这些优势,适用于多种平台。ZFS的强大功能和灵活性使其成为企业级存储的理想选择。
ZFS(Zettabyte File System)是一种先进的文件系统和管理工具,由Sun Microsystems公司开发,现已成为OpenZFS项目的一部分,ZFS以其独特的架构和丰富的特性,在数据存储和管理领域享有盛誉,本文将详细解析ZFS文件系统的核心特性,帮助读者深入了解其强大功能和优势。
1. 数据完整性
ZFS最引人注目的特性之一是其对数据完整性的高度重视,通过使用校验和(checksum)和冗余数据块(raidz),ZFS能够在数据读写过程中自动检测和修复错误,这种机制大大降低了数据损坏的风险,确保了存储系统的可靠性。
2. 池存储管理
ZFS采用池(pool)的概念来管理存储空间,用户可以灵活地将多个物理磁盘组合成一个逻辑存储池,这种设计简化了存储管理,提高了资源利用率,用户可以根据需要动态地扩展或缩减存储池,无需重新格式化磁盘。
3. 快照与克隆
ZFS支持快速创建文件系统的快照(snapshot),这些快照几乎不占用额外空间,因为它们只记录数据的变更部分,快照可以用于数据备份、恢复和历史版本管理,ZFS还支持从快照创建克隆(clone),克隆是一个可写的独立文件系统,适用于测试和开发环境。
4. 数据压缩
ZFS内置了多种数据压缩算法,如LZ4、gzip等,用户可以根据需求选择合适的压缩级别,数据压缩不仅可以节省存储空间,还能提高I/O性能,因为压缩后的数据减少了磁盘读写操作。
5. 存储层级
ZFS支持多种存储层级,包括磁盘、SSD和内存,用户可以将SSD用作缓存(L2ARC)或日志设备(ZIL),以提升系统性能,这种灵活的存储层级设计,使得ZFS能够适应不同的应用场景和性能需求。
6. 数据去重
ZFS提供了数据去重(deduplication)功能,能够识别和消除存储中的重复数据块,从而节省存储空间,虽然数据去重会消耗一定的CPU和内存资源,但对于数据重复率高的场景,其带来的空间节省效果非常显著。
7. 自我修复
ZFS具备自我修复能力,当检测到数据损坏时,会自动尝试从冗余数据块中恢复数据,这种机制大大提高了系统的可靠性和数据的安全性。
8. 易于管理
ZFS提供了丰富的命令行工具和图形化管理界面,使得存储管理变得简单高效,用户可以通过命令行或GUI轻松地进行存储池创建、文件系统管理、快照和克隆操作等。
9. 高性能
ZFS在设计上注重性能优化,支持高效的I/O调度和并发处理机制,其独特的ARC(Adaptive Replacement Cache)算法,能够智能地缓存热点数据,显著提升系统性能。
10. 可扩展性
ZFS具有良好的可扩展性,支持从几十GB到数ZB的超大规模存储,无论是小型服务器还是大型数据中心,ZFS都能提供稳定高效的存储解决方案。
11. 多平台支持
ZFS最初是为Solaris操作系统开发的,但现在已经支持多种平台,包括Linux、FreeBSD和macOS等,这种跨平台的支持,使得ZFS在各种环境中都能得到广泛应用。
12. 安全性
ZFS提供了多种安全特性,如加密存储、细粒度权限控制等,确保数据的安全性,用户可以根据需要启用加密功能,保护敏感数据不被未授权访问。
ZFS文件系统以其卓越的数据完整性、灵活的存储管理、高效的性能优化和丰富的功能特性,成为现代存储解决方案的理想选择,无论是企业级应用还是个人用户,ZFS都能提供可靠、高效和安全的存储服务,通过深入了解ZFS的这些特性,用户可以更好地利用其优势,构建稳定高效的存储系统。
相关关键词
ZFS, 文件系统, 数据完整性, 校验和, 冗余数据块, 池存储管理, 快照, 克隆, 数据压缩, 存储层级, 数据去重, 自我修复, 易于管理, 高性能, 可扩展性, 多平台支持, 安全性, LZ4, gzip, L2ARC, ZIL, ARC算法, Solaris, Linux, FreeBSD, macOS, 加密存储, 权限控制, 存储解决方案, I/O调度, 并发处理, 磁盘管理, 存储优化, 数据备份, 数据恢复, 历史版本管理, 测试环境, 开发环境, 存储空间, 动态扩展, 资源利用率, 命令行工具, 图形化管理界面, 热点数据, 超大规模存储, 数据中心, 敏感数据, 未授权访问, 存储服务, 稳定高效, 存储系统
本文标签属性:
ZFS文件系统特性详解:zfs命令